Second T20I of the series of 5 T20I matches between Bangladesh and Australia is going to be played at Sher-e-Bangla National Cricket Stadium, Dhaka on August 4th 2021. This is going to be the first T20I series between the teams.

Sher-e-Bangla National Cricket Stadium, Dhaka

Toss and Pitch:

Team preferred to field first after winning the toss in 26 games out of 48 played games, and the selection behaves neutral to the teams, as the teams won 13 times and lost 13 times, too. 1 match was called off without a ball (abandoned) and 2 matches were cancelled.

Last 5 (completed) match results at the venue, when the team chose to field first, are LWLLW.

On the other hand, the teams, who chose to bat first, won 10 times and lost 9 times.

Last 5 (completed) match results at the venue, when the team chose to bat first, are WLLLL.

Overall, 23 times the teams won the toss, won the matches and lost 22 times.

Last 5 (completed) match results at the venue, while winning the toss, are LWLWL.

Particularly, for Bangladesh, the team won the toss 12 times in 27 games and the team won 6 times and lost 6 times, too.

Last 5 (completed) match results of Bangladesh at the venue, while winning the toss, are WWLLW.

Last 5 (completed) match results of Bangladesh at the venue, while losing the toss, are WWLWL.

The first batting team won the match 23 times. Whereas, the teams, who batted second, won the match 22 times.

Last 5 (completed) match results at the venue, while the team bat first, are WLWWW.

Score:

The lowest defended total was 129 runs in 2016, and the highest successful chase was 194 runs in 2018.

The first inning lowest total was 72 runs in 2014 and the highest total was 191 runs in 2010. For the second inning, the lowest total was 82 runs (according to RR) in 2014 and the highest was 194 runs in 2018.

The batting average of the first innings is 23.73 and 20.73 is for the second innings.
